Celiac Disease in Children with Moderate-to-Severe Iron-deficiency Anemia

Celiac disease is linked to 4% of children with moderate-to-severe iron-deficiency anemia. This study highlights the importance of screening for celiac disease in anemic pediatric patients.

Background:

  • Iron-deficiency anemia is common in children.
  • Celiac disease is an autoimmune disorder triggered by gluten.
  • The association between anemia and celiac disease in pediatric populations requires further investigation.

Purpose of the Study:

  • To determine the prevalence of celiac disease among children with moderate to severe iron-deficiency anemia.
  • To assess the association between iron-deficiency anemia and celiac disease in pediatric patients.

Main Methods:

  • A cross-sectional analytical study involving children aged 1-12 years.
  • Serum IgA-tissue transglutaminase levels were measured.
  • Positive serology prompted upper gastrointestinal endoscopy and duodenal biopsy for celiac disease diagnosis (Marsh grade 3).

Main Results:

  • 10.5% of anemic children and 2% of controls had positive celiac serology (OR 5.33).
  • 3.9% of anemic children were diagnosed with celiac disease via biopsy, compared to 0% in controls.
  • A significant association was found between moderate-to-severe anemia and celiac disease.

Conclusions:

  • Celiac disease is associated with approximately 4% of children presenting with moderate-to-severe anemia in this Northern Indian tertiary-care hospital setting.
  • These findings underscore the need for celiac disease screening in anemic children.
  • Early diagnosis and management of celiac disease can prevent long-term complications.
